The leaflet Game are giving out says to go to xbox.com/en-gb/support to get a data transfer cable for moving your 20gb drive contents to your new 120gb drive, but there's no mention of it there. It IS on the US xbox support site though, and it's free, but you need to print out a form & fill in the serial numbers from both the old & new consoles before you can send off for the cable....

A bloke in Game said they're honouring the 210 trade in price if you buy the Elite outright then bring the Premium back in after you've migrated the data...

also, what happens to the games you've downloaded? heard some nasty rumour that you need to re-download 'em each time you want to play them on the new machine?? or you have to be logged in or something
 
If you get the cable, everything transfers.... BUT it also wipes the new HD during the transfer process, so you'd lose anything saved on that.
